zoukankan      html  css  js  c++  java
  • spring boot入门小案例

    spring boot 入门小案例搭建

    (1) 在Eclipse中新建一个maven project项目,目录结构如下所示:

    cn.com.rxyb中存放spring boot的启动类,application.properties中放spring boot相关配置

    (2) 在pom.xml中加入spring boot 依赖包

    (3)在cn.com.rxyb中新建启动类APP

     1 package cn.com.rxyb;
     2 import org.springframework.boot.SpringApplication;
     3 import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
     4 import org.springframework.boot.autoconfigure.SpringBootApplication;
     5 import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
     6 
     7 @SpringBootApplication
     8 @EnableAutoConfiguration(exclude= {DataSourceAutoConfiguration.class})
     9 public class App {
    10 
    11     public static void main(String[] args) {
    12         SpringApplication.run(App.class, args);
    13     }
    14 }
    APP.java启动类

    继续在包中创建测试Controller控制器

     1 package cn.com.rxyb;
     2 import org.springframework.web.bind.annotation.GetMapping;
     3 import org.springframework.web.bind.annotation.RestController;
     4 
     5 @RestController
     6 public class TestController {
     7 
     8     @GetMapping("hello")
     9     public String helloword() {
    10         return "hello";
    11     }
    12     
    13     @GetMapping("hello2")
    14     public String helloworkd2() {
    15         return "hello2";
    16     }
    17 }
    TestController.java控制器

    (4)接下来可以在启动类APP中右键--->run as---->java Application来启动spring boot。之后打开浏览器输入http://localhost:8080/hello直接访问。

    如果想在hello前面加名字空间的话,可以在application.properties中做如下配置:

    server.context-path=/demo
    

      这样我们就在hello之前加入了/demo名字空间,在访问hello的时候,hello之前必须加/demo名字空间才可以访问

    今天的spring boot入门小案例学习就到这里,明天继续。

  • 相关阅读:
    css 解决fixed 布局下不能滚动的问题
    js 正则常用函数 会正则得永生
    巧用call,appl有 根据对象某一属性求最大值
    锚点 , angular 锚点 vue锚点
    css 改变浏览器滚动条的样式
    angular 常用插件集合
    angular4,angular6 父组件异步获取数据传值子组件 undefined 问题
    angular组件之间的通讯
    tomcat的配置详解:[1]tomcat绑定域名
    click 绑定(三)防止事件冒泡
  • 原文地址:https://www.cnblogs.com/lihuibin/p/10149940.html
Copyright © 2011-2022 走看看